Barbecue Recipes Barbecued Chicken Wings Recipe
Ingredients:
20 chicken wings, wing tips removed
Olive oil
1/2 cup ketchup
1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
2 tbsp. dark brown sugar
4 tsp. granulated garlic
4 tsp. Worcestershire sauce
3 tsp. Tabasco sauce
2 tsp. Dijon mustard
2 tsp. paprika
2 tsp. chili powder
Instructions:
- In a large bowl, combine ketchup, balsamic vinegar, brown sugar, garlic, worcestershire sauce, tabasco sauce, dijon mustard, paprika and chili powder. Stir well.
- Clean the wings with cold water and dry.
- Put the wings in large seal able plastic bags and pour the marinade into the bags and seal tight. Shake the bags to ensure that the marinade is evenly distributed among the wings. Allow to marinade in the refrigerator for at least six hours.
- Remove the wings from the refrigerator and brush the wings with olive oil.
- Sear the wings over direct, medium heat for 4-6 minutes or until well marked. Then grill over indirect medium heat for 8-10 minutes or until meat is cooked through and no longer pink .
